Concrete Foundation Pouring in Greenville, SC

Concrete foundation pouring services involve the process of creating a stable and durable base for residential or commercial structures. This service covers a variety of projects, including new home construction, additions, garage foundations, basement floors, and repair work for existing foundations. Property owners should understand the importance of proper site preparation, soil assessment, and the quality of materials used to ensure the foundation’s longevity and stability. Clear communication about project scope, timeline, and any necessary permits can help homeowners make informed decisions before requesting these services.

Before requesting concrete foundation pouring, property owners often want to know about the typical steps involved, such as excavation, form setting, reinforcement placement, and the pouring process itself. It’s also useful to consider factors like weather conditions, drainage, and potential soil issues that could affect the foundation’s performance. Having a clear understanding of these elements can help homeowners prepare for the project and ensure that the foundation will support the structure safely and effectively over time.

FAQ

Concrete Foundation Pouring Questions

What types of projects require a concrete foundation? Foundations are essential for new construction, additions, and repairs to ensure stability and support for structures in Greenville and nearby areas.

How thick should a concrete foundation be? The typical thickness varies based on the project, but generally ranges from 6 to 12 inches to provide adequate support for residential and commercial buildings.

What factors influence the quality of a poured concrete foundation? Proper site preparation, quality materials, and correct pouring techniques are key factors that affect foundation durability and stability.

Is a concrete foundation suitable for all soil types? Concrete foundations can be adapted for various soil conditions, but soil stability and drainage are important considerations for proper installation.
